Radiology generates a high volume of clinical information that must be documented accurately and quickly. Radiology Transcription is evolving with artificial intelligence (AI), helping convert physician dictation into clear, organised reports. AI can speed up documentation and reduce repetitive work, but human expertise remains essential for reviewing medical terminology, context, and accuracy.

How AI Is Transforming Radiology Transcription

AI powered speech recognition can convert a radiologist’s dictation into text within seconds. Natural language processing can then identify relevant clinical information and help organise it into a standard report format.

This approach can reduce manual data entry and help radiologists complete reports more efficiently. AI can also support integration with radiology information systems, electronic health records, and other clinical platforms, creating a smoother documentation workflow.

Major Benefits of AI in Radiology Reporting

AI offers several practical benefits for radiology practices, hospitals, and imaging centres.

Faster Documentation

AI can transcribe dictated content almost instantly, reducing the time between examination, dictation, and report completion. Faster reporting can also help referring physicians receive important findings sooner.

Improved Workflow Efficiency

Radiologists can spend less time on repetitive documentation tasks. AI handles initial transcription while professionals focus on reviewing images, interpreting findings, and communicating with care teams.

Consistent Report Structure

AI tools can support standard templates and consistent formatting. This makes reports easier to read and can improve the organisation of clinical information.

Support for High Patient Volumes

Growing imaging volumes can increase documentation demands. AI can help manage routine transcription tasks without adding the same level of manual effort.

Reduced Administrative Burden

Automating repetitive transcription work can reduce administrative pressure on radiologists and staff. This may allow healthcare teams to focus more attention on patient care and other clinical responsibilities.

Challenges Healthcare Providers Need to Consider

AI brings clear advantages, but implementation requires careful planning.

Transcription Accuracy

AI may misunderstand accents, unclear speech, abbreviations, or specialised medical terms. Even a small error can change the meaning of a radiology report. Human review is therefore important before final approval.

Patient Data Security

Radiology reports contain protected health information. AI solutions must have appropriate safeguards for storing, processing, and transferring patient information. Healthcare organisations should also evaluate privacy and security requirements before adopting an AI platform.

System Integration

AI tools need to work effectively with existing PACS, RIS, EHR, and reporting systems. Poor integration can create additional manual work instead of simplifying the workflow.

Human Oversight

AI should support clinical professionals rather than replace their judgement. A qualified reviewer can identify transcription errors, correct terminology, and ensure that the final report accurately reflects the radiologist’s intended meaning.

What Does the Future Hold for AI in Radiology?

AI is moving beyond basic speech to text conversion. Future tools are expected to provide more intelligent support throughout the reporting process.

Generative AI for Report Assistance

Generative AI may help organise clinical information, improve report language, identify inconsistencies, and assist with report summaries. However, these capabilities still require appropriate validation and professional oversight.

Smarter Clinical Workflows

Future AI systems may connect dictation, reporting, imaging, and electronic health records more efficiently. Better interoperability could reduce duplicate data entry and make information easier to access across healthcare systems.

Human and AI Collaboration

The most effective approach is likely to combine AI automation with human expertise. AI can manage routine documentation, while radiologists and trained transcription professionals focus on accuracy, context, quality control, and final review.
